Deionized Water
Distilled Deionized Water (H2O) is ultra-pure water that meets ASTM D1193 Type II specifications for laboratory, datacenter cooling, AI infrastructure, electronics manufacturing, and analytical applications. Each batch is tested and verified with a Certificate of Analysis showing actual test results including NIST-traceable conductivity measurements.
Property | Value |
Chemical Formula | H2O |
Molecular Weight | 18.015 g/mol |
Appearance | Clear, odorless |
Conductivity @ 25°C | 0.050 µS/cm (Traceable to NIST SRM 3193) |
Specific Gravity | 1.000 at 20°C |
pH | 6.5 - 7.0 at 25°C |
Resistivity | >18 MΩ-cm at 25°C |
Chloride (Cl) | <1 ppb |
Sodium (Na) | <1.0 ppb |
Silicate (as SiO4) | <1.0 ppm |
Heavy Metal (as Pb) | 6 ppb |
Residue After Evap. | 35 ppb maximum |
Grade | ASTM D1193 Type II |
Industry | Laboratory, Biotechnology, Datacenter, Industrial, Electronics, Pharmaceutical |
Datacenter & High-Performance Computing Cooling: Critical coolant for liquid cooling infrastructure in enterprise datacenters and hyperscale facilities. Ultra-low conductivity (0.050 µS/cm) prevents corrosion, scaling, and electrical conductivity issues in direct-to-chip cooling systems, cold plates, and immersion cooling deployments.
AI Infrastructure & GPU Cluster Cooling: Essential cooling medium for AI training clusters and GPU-accelerated computing systems generating extreme heat loads from NVIDIA H100, A100, AMD MI300 accelerators. Prevents mineral buildup in microchannel heat exchangers and maintains consistent cooling performance in both air-assisted liquid cooling and full immersion systems.
Semiconductor & Electronics Manufacturing: Precision cleaning and rinsing of silicon wafers, circuit boards, and microelectronic components. Meets stringent purity requirements for photolithography, wet etching, wafer cleaning, and final rinse processes. Essential for manufacturing PCBs, integrated circuits, and MEMS devices where ionic contamination must be eliminated.
Laboratory Analysis & Analytical Testing: Critical reagent for preparing standards, buffers, and mobile phases in HPLC, GC-MS, ICP-MS, and other analytical instrumentation. ASTM Type II specifications ensure accurate, reproducible results in trace analysis, environmental testing, pharmaceutical QC, and research applications.
Pharmaceutical & Biotechnology: High-purity water for buffer preparation, cell culture media, equipment rinsing, and cleaning validation. Suitable for laboratory research, bioreactor operations, and equipment maintenance in drug development and biotech facilities.
Battery Technologies & Energy Storage: Essential for lithium-ion battery production, lead-acid battery maintenance, and electrolyte preparation. Critical for EV battery manufacturing, grid-scale storage systems, and UPS battery maintenance where water purity impacts performance and longevity.
Industrial Processing: Cooling system maintenance for high-performance equipment, laser cutting systems, CNC coolant preparation, steam generation, and industrial humidification. Prevents scale buildup and corrosion in boilers, heat exchangers, and closed-loop cooling systems.
Medical & Dental Equipment: Equipment rinsing, autoclave operation, and medical device cleaning. Used in dental clinics for ultrasonic cleaners, sterilization equipment, and handpiece maintenance where ultra-low mineral content prevents scale deposits.
Deionized water requires proper handling to maintain purity specifications. Store in clean, non-metallic containers such as HDPE or PTFE to prevent ionic contamination. Keep containers sealed and minimize exposure to air to prevent CO2 absorption, which can lower pH and increase conductivity over time. Avoid storage in glass or metal containers. Store in a cool, dry location away from direct sunlight and heat sources. For datacenter and industrial cooling applications, implement proper system design to prevent microbial growth and maintain water quality throughout circulation systems. Regular conductivity monitoring recommended to verify ongoing quality maintenance. Not intended for human consumption.
